ENVIRONMENT NEWS

  • Engineers say a new ice boom is reducing how often and how long ice flows down the river — a step intended to help local officials manage waterway conditions. They expect this measure to ease navigation issues during icy weather.  WBEN

HEALTH NEWS

  • Today, on World Parkinson’s Day, doctors from the University at Buffalo stress the need for early detection as signs like a softer voice and smaller handwriting may go unnoticed + new non-invasive surgical treatments are expected soon.  WGRZ

REAL ESTATE NEWS

  • Ciminelli plans to build 160 for-sale townhomes and Sawyer's Landing will add 14 apartments at Muir Woods north of UB North Campus. The fourth housing project is under review and will boost local housing options.  The Buffalo News
